Understanding NIPT Philippines and Its Purpose

Noninvasive prenatal testing is a type of prenatal genetic screening that analyzes fragments of cell-free DNA circulating in the pregnant person’s bloodstream. Some of this DNA comes from the placenta and can provide information about the likelihood of certain chromosomal abnormalities. NIPT Philippines refers to the availability of this screening option for expecting parents seeking prenatal genetic information within the Philippines. The procedure generally requires only a blood draw from the pregnant patient, making it different from diagnostic procedures that require samples from inside the uterus. NIPT is commonly used to screen for chromosomal conditions such as trisomy 21, trisomy 18, and trisomy 13. It is important to understand that NIPT is a screening test rather than a diagnostic test, so its results indicate risk rather than providing absolute confirmation. How Noninvasive Prenatal Testing Works

The NIPT process starts with the collection of a blood sample from the pregnant patient. This blood contains cell-free DNA, including fragments that originate from placental tissue. Specialized laboratory methods analyze these DNA fragments to look for patterns associated with selected chromosomal conditions. Because the sample is obtained from the mother’s bloodstream, the process does not involve entering the uterus or directly collecting fetal tissue. This makes NIPT different from procedures such as chorionic villus sampling and amniocentesis, which are invasive diagnostic tests. Once laboratory analysis is completed, the findings are reported according to the testing company’s reporting system and the conditions included in the selected panel. Chromosomal Conditions Commonly Screened by NIPT

A major reason parents explore NIPT Philippines is the ability to screen for several common chromosomal conditions through a maternal blood sample. Trisomy 21, which is associated with Down syndrome, is one of the primary conditions evaluated by many NIPT tests. Trisomy 18, associated with Edwards syndrome, is another commonly screened chromosomal condition. Trisomy 13, associated with Patau syndrome, is also included in many standard NIPT panels. Some testing providers offer additional screening for sex chromosome differences or other conditions, depending on the laboratory and package selected. The availability of expanded testing does not necessarily mean that every additional condition has the same level of evidence or screening performance as the most commonly evaluated trisomies. Patients should therefore ask specifically what their chosen NIPT test covers rather than assuming that all NIPT packages provide identical information. Understanding the scope of the test can help parents have more realistic expectations about what their results may reveal.

When Is the Right Time to Have NIPT?

The timing of prenatal genetic screening can affect whether a laboratory is able to produce a usable result. Cell-free DNA screening is generally available beginning at around 10 weeks of pregnancy, although exact requirements can vary among laboratories and providers. At this stage, there is typically enough placental DNA circulating in the maternal bloodstream for laboratory analysis. The proportion of placental DNA in the sample is often described as the fetal fraction, and insufficient fetal fraction can sometimes result in a test that cannot provide a reportable result. A nonreportable result does not necessarily mean that the pregnancy has a chromosomal abnormality, but it may require additional medical evaluation depending on the circumstances. Patients should confirm their gestational age with their obstetrician and ask the testing provider about its minimum gestational-age requirement. Planning the test at the appropriate stage can help reduce avoidable delays and ensure that the screening is performed according to the laboratory’s protocol.

Making Sense of NIPT Results

NIPT results are usually presented as a screening assessment indicating a lower or higher likelihood for the chromosomal conditions included in the test. A low-risk result means that the likelihood of the screened condition has been reduced, but it does not guarantee that the fetus is completely free from genetic or structural abnormalities. A high-risk result means that the likelihood of the specified condition is increased and that additional assessment may be appropriate. A high-risk screening result does not automatically establish that the fetus has the condition because NIPT can produce false-positive results. Healthcare professionals may recommend genetic counseling, detailed ultrasound assessment, and diagnostic testing after a high-risk result. Diagnostic procedures such as chorionic villus sampling or amniocentesis can provide more definitive information when confirmation is needed. Patients should therefore discuss their results with an appropriate healthcare professional rather than interpreting the report independently or making major decisions based solely on the screening result.

NIPT and Ultrasound Provide Different Information

NIPT is valuable, but it is only one part of comprehensive prenatal care. The test primarily focuses on screening for selected chromosomal conditions through analysis of cell-free DNA. Ultrasound, on the other hand, provides visual information about fetal growth, anatomy, development, and certain structural features. A normal NIPT result does not replace the need for appropriate pregnancy ultrasound examinations. Ultrasound may identify structural concerns that NIPT is not designed to detect. Professional prenatal care may therefore include both genetic screening and ultrasound assessment, depending on the pregnancy and the recommendations of the healthcare provider. Understanding the different purposes of these tests can help expecting parents avoid viewing one screening method as a substitute for every other form of prenatal monitoring.

Important Limitations of NIPT

Although NIPT is an advanced prenatal screening tool, it does not evaluate every possible genetic disorder or fetal health concern. A low-risk result cannot rule out every chromosomal condition, genetic disease, birth defect, or structural abnormality. Likewise, a high-risk result does not automatically mean that the fetus has the condition identified by the screening report. False-positive and false-negative results are possible because NIPT estimates risk rather than providing a definitive diagnosis. Some tests may also produce a nonreportable result because there is not enough usable DNA for analysis or because of other technical or pregnancy-related factors. Certain pregnancy circumstances can also make results more challenging to interpret, which is why personal medical information should be discussed with the healthcare provider before testing. Understanding these limitations helps parents use NIPT results as one part of a broader prenatal care plan.

What is a nonreportable NIPT result?

A nonreportable result means the laboratory could not provide a usable screening result. One possible reason is an insufficient amount of cell-free DNA in the sample, although other factors can contribute. The appropriate next step should be discussed with the patient’s healthcare provider.
